2009 ICD-9-CM Diagnosis Code 527.7
Disturbance of salivary secretion
527.6
527.8
527.7 is a billable ICD-9-CM medical code that can be used to specify a diagnosis on a reimbursement claim.
Newer versions of 527.7:
2010
Diagnosis Definition(s)
Dry mouth. It occurs when the body is not able to make enough saliva.
dryness of the mouth due to salivary gland secretion dysfunction.
An oral condition in which salivary flow is reduced. --2004
